Catch SGIA's Last Direct-to-Garment Digital Workshop for 2007 - Popular regional workshop heads to Irvine, California
Fairfax, Virginia -- Time is running out for garment decorators who want, before the end of the year, hands-on training on the latest digital apparel printing technologies within a working production environment.
The SGIA Direct-to-Garment Digital regional workshop -- September 20-21 at the Irvine, California-based headquarters of SGIA member Roland DGA Corp. -- explores the latest digital platforms for apparel printing, including direct-to-garment digital, large-format sublimation equipment and digital heat transfer paper systems. http://www.sgia.org/training_and_education/SGIA_workshops/direct_to_garment/
Students will leave with the knowledge to make sound decisions on:
Digital workflow and resource management
Costs, pricing and profit analysis
Investment levels and cost controls

SGIA -- Supporting the Leaders of the Digital & Screen Printing Community
"Specialty imaging" comprises digital imaging, screen printing and the many other imaging technologies SGIA members use, including those they'll tap in the future. These are the imaging processes and technologies employed to create new products and to enhance existing products including point-of-purchase displays, signs, advertisements, garments, containers and vehicles.
